I was bored so i did something less boring:

Image
Syntax highlighting working 8-)

I also changed the font to a fixed-width font, its currently a hybrid of Lucida Console, Verdana and MS Sans Serif :lol:

Still a bit buggy, but works good if you dont put text straight before or after block comments.

The syntax colors can be changed in a file like this:

Code: Select all

#DefaultColor=CACACA
#Variables=8D8D8D
#Floats=21B0CC
#Integers=FFFFFF
#Comments=007500

#CompilerEnums=FFFF00
#CompilerDirectives=FF00FF
#GameLoops=FFFFFF
#DataTypes=FFFF75
#ControlStructures=2D72FF
#Functions=FF3A13
#Enums=FF893D


#CompilerEnums
PC
PSX


#CompilerDirectives
\#ifdef
\#endif
\#else


#GameLoops
LEVELSTART
LEVELEND
MISSIONSTART
MISSIONEND


#DataTypes
ARROW_DATA
CRANE_DATA
BONUS
CAR_DATA
CHAR_DATA
CONVEYOR
COUNTER
CRUSHER
DESTRUCTOR
DOOR_DATA
GENERATOR
LIGHT
MAP_ZONE
OBJ_DATA
...
Therefore its fully moddable. You can add own colors for any keyword you wish.

EditPlus highlights this file nicely with its syntax file syntax highlight 8-) (even though mine is slightly different to the one EditPlus uses)

I also made the fonts easier to edit: storing each font in a BMP file now.
